20.9% of flies carrying Cdk7P140S in a heterozygous Df(1)JB254 P{snf+,dhd+} background (the Df(1)JB254 chromosome is deficient for Cdk7, snf and dhd and snf and dhd function is provided by the P{snf+,dhd+} transgene) at the restrictive temperature show shape deformities and size reduction in the wing. No brittle bristles or cuticle defects are seen in these animals. 36.3% of flies carrying Cdk7P140S in a homozygous Df(1)JB254 P{snf+,dhd+} background at the restrictive temperature show shape deformities and size reduction in the wing, 16.3% have brittle bristles and 5% have cuticle defects. Animals carrying Cdk7P140S in a Df(1)JB254 P{snf+,dhd+} background do not show abnormal amounts of apoptosis in the imaginal discs or central nervous system.

Flies carrying Cdk7P140S in a Df(1)JB254 P{snf+,dhd+} background (referred to as "cdk7ts" flies) are fully viable at 18oC but are not viable at 27oC or above. After transfer of cdk7ts females to the restrictive temperature, many of the embryos laid during the first 36 hours will eclose as larvae, and most of those embryos that fail to eclose show defects late in development. Mutant embryos exhibit gradually earlier developmental arrest to a point where the embryonic nuclear division program fails to be initiated. cdk7ts females cease to lay eggs after 3-4 days at the restrictive temperature. When pupae are transferred to the restrictive temperature (29oC), viable cdk7ts adults continue to eclose for up to 3 days after the temperature shift. These adults are viable at 29oC but show progressively stronger defects in mitotically active tissues with increasing time spent at 29oC. The first defect seen in females is a depletion of follicle cells, followed by the appearance of cysts containing fewer than 16 germ cells.

When Df(1)JB254 ; Cdk7P140S ; P{snf+,dhd+} animals are shifted to 29[o]C, the size of the eye imaginal disc becomes smaller in proportion to the time that th animals are kept at this temperature. When maintained at 29[o]C for three days, BrdU incorporation is reduced.

Flies carrying Cdk7P140S in a heterozygous Df(1)JB254 P{snf+,dhd+} background (the Df(1)JB254 chromosome is deficient for Cdk7, snf and dhd and snf and dhd function is provided by the P{snf+,dhd+} transgene) at the restrictive temperature that are also carrying one copy of haync2, haync2rv2 or haync2rv8 show brittle bristle and cuticle defect phenotypes. Flies carrying Cdk7P140S in a heterozygous Df(1)JB254 P{snf+,dhd+} background at the restrictive temperature that are also carrying one copy of haync2rv7 have brittle bristles. The penetrance of the wing phenotypes (shape deformities and size reduction) seen in flies carrying Cdk7P140S in a heterozygous Df(1)JB254 P{snf+,dhd+} background at the restrictive temperature is increased if they are also carrying one copy of haync2rv8. These animals do not show abnormal amounts of apoptosis in the imaginal discs or central nervous system.
